One is that Boost Mobile phones are no contract. They offer monthly unlimited with shrinkage. As you pay on time, payments shrink from $50 a month to as low as $35 a month. Boost Mobile also proposes international calling and a daily unlimited option with nationwide talk, text messaging, web, and email.
